The event, which is gaining popularity around the world, is where people dance to music played through wireless headphones.


Rather than using a speaker system, music is broadcast via a radio transmitter, and the signal is picked up by wireless headphone receivers worn by the participants.​


Those without the headphones hear no music, giving the effect of a room full of people dancing to nothing.


In the earliest days of silent discos, music was transmitted on a single channel. More channels have been introduced, transmitting different music for different groups and interests all dancing together.
